public class SignaturePropertyType extends java.lang.ObjectJava class for SignaturePropertyType complex type.
The following schema fragment specifies the expected content contained within this class.
<complexType name="SignaturePropertyType"> <complexContent> <restriction base="{http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ema}anyType"> <choice maxOccurs="unbounded"> <any processContents='lax' namespace='##other'/> </choice> <attribute name="Target" use="required" type="{http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ema}anyURI" /> <attribute name="Id" type="{http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ema}ID" /> </restriction> </complexContent> </complexType>

getContent
public java.util.List<java.lang.Object> getContent()
Gets the value of the content property.This accessor method returns a reference to the live list, not a snapshot. Therefore any modification you make to the returned list will be present inside the JAXB object. This is why there is not a
setmethod for the content property.For example, to add a new item, do as follows:
getContent().add(newItem);Objects of the following type(s) are allowed in the list
StringObjectElement
